Choosing the Right Size of Monster Skips

Available Sizes and Capacities

Monster Skips come in various sizes, commonly categorized as:

  • 2 Yard Skip: Suitable for small renovations or garden waste.
  • 4 Yard Skip: Ideal for medium-sized projects like moderate home renovations.
  • 6 Yard Skip: Perfect for larger home projects and small commercial jobs.
  • 8 Yard Skip: A go-to choice for busy building sites requiring significant waste management.
  • 12 Yard Skip: Best suited for larger commercial projects and extensive residential cleanouts.
  • 16 Yard Skip: Recommended for major construction work and industrial applications.

How to Determine the Right Size

To choose the right size of Monster Skips, consider the following:

  • Volume of Waste: Estimate the amount of waste generated; larger volumes typically require larger skips.
  • Type of Waste: Different projects may have different waste compositions, influencing the size needed.
  • Project Duration: Longer projects might accumulate more waste, necessitating a larger skip.

Comparing Sizes for Different Projects

Understanding how various skip sizes compare can also assist in making an informed decision. For instance, a 2-yard skip can hold approximately 20 to 30 black bags of waste, while a 12-yard skip can manage around 100 black bags, making it suitable for extensive refurbishments or major construction tasks.

Waste Management Best Practices with Monster Skips

Sorting and Recycling Waste

Sorting your waste properly can lead to better recycling rates and lower disposal costs. Here’s how you can effectively manage waste:

  • Separate Materials: Break down waste into categories such as wood, metal, and electronic waste.
  • Use Recycling Facilities: Whenever possible, utilize local recycling centers for materials that cannot go into skips.
  • Educate Your Team: If working on a large project, ensure that everyone involved understands sorting protocols.

What Can and Cannot Be Placed in Monster Skips

It is essential to know what you can and cannot dispose of in Monster Skips. Acceptable items typically include:

  • General waste from homes and businesses
  • Construction debris (except hazardous materials)
  • Furniture and appliances

Items not allowed include:

  • Hazardous waste (chemicals, asbestos, etc.)
  • Flammable materials
  • Electrical items such as televisions and microwaves

Safety Guidelines When Using Monster Skips

Maintaining safety while using skips is paramount. Ensure that:

  • Skip isn’t overloaded above its fill line.
  • Children and pets are kept at a safe distance from the skip.
  • Heavy items are placed at the bottom to prevent accidents while loading.
